The cheapest way to get from Sutton to Didcot is to drive which costs £14 - £21 and takes 1h 31m.
The fastest way to get from Sutton to Didcot is to drive which takes 1h 31m and costs £14 - £21.
No, there is no direct train from Sutton to Didcot. However, there are services departing from Sutton (London) and arriving at Didcot Parkway via Wimbledon station and London Paddington.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 34m.
The distance between Sutton and Didcot is 66 miles. The road distance is 59.1 miles.
The best way to get from Sutton to Didcot without a car is to train and subway which takes 1h 34m and costs £30 - £60.
It takes approximately 1h 34m to get from Sutton to Didcot, including transfers.
Sutton to Didcot train services, operated by Southern, depart from Sutton (London) station.
The best way to get from Sutton to Didcot is to bus which takes 2h 34m and costs £35 - £65. Alternatively, you can train, which costs £26 - £60 and takes 2h 33m.
Sutton to Didcot train services, operated by Southern, arrive at Clapham Junction station.
Yes, the driving distance between Sutton to Didcot is 59 miles. It takes approximately 1h 31m to drive from Sutton to Didcot.
